Anthony Mauro v. Southern New England Telecommunications, Inc.

U.S. Court of Appeals, Second Circuit · Decided 2000-03-30

From the opinion

PER CURIAM: Plaintiff-appellant Anthony Mauro appeals from a judgment entered on April 16, 1999, granting summary judgment in favor of defendant-appellee Southern New -England Telecommunications, Inc.
